Server Video Still Capture MCP

Server Video Still Capture MCP

Un server MCP dedicat pentru captură de imagini și gestionare a camerelor cu suport AI, ideal pentru fluxuri de lucru ce necesită date vizuale reale și instantanee la cerere.

Ce face serverul “Video Still Capture” MCP?

Video Still Capture MCP este un server Model Context Protocol (MCP) bazat pe Python, conceput pentru a oferi asistenților AI acces și control facil asupra webcam-urilor și surselor video folosind OpenCV. Acest server pune la dispoziție unelte ce permit modelelor lingvistice și agenților AI să captureze imagini, să gestioneze conexiunile video și să manipuleze setările camerei precum luminozitatea, contrastul și rezoluția. Îmbunătățește fluxurile de dezvoltare permițând sarcini AI precum captură foto la cerere, procesare de bază a imaginilor (de ex. oglindire orizontală) și ajustarea proprietăților camerei, toate prin interfețe MCP standardizate. Acest lucru îl face deosebit de util în scenarii unde contextul vizual sau datele de imagine din lumea reală sunt necesare pentru sarcini AI, automatizare sau interacțiuni cu utilizatorii.

Listă de Prompt-uri

Nu sunt menționate șabloane explicite de prompt în depozit sau documentație.

Listă de Resurse

Nu sunt menționate resurse MCP explicite în depozit sau documentație.

Listă de Unelte

  • quick_capture
    Capturează o singură imagine de la o cameră sau sursă video fără a necesita gestionarea conexiunilor persistente. Permite agenților AI să obțină rapid o imagine statică de la un dispozitiv compatibil OpenCV.

Pot exista și alte unelte, însă doar quick_capture este menționat în documentația disponibilă.

Cazuri de utilizare pentru acest server MCP

  • Captură de imagini la cerere
    Permite dezvoltatorilor sau agenților AI să facă o fotografie în timp real de la un webcam pentru analiză vizuală, documentare sau interacțiune cu utilizatorul.
  • Ajustarea setărilor camerei
    Permite modificarea programatică a proprietăților camerei, precum luminozitate, contrast și rezoluție, facilitând condiții de imagine adaptabile.
  • Procesare imagine
    Suportă transformări simple precum oglindirea orizontală, făcând ușoară preprocesarea imaginilor pentru sarcini ulterioare.
  • Experimentare cu viziune AI
    Ușurează integrarea datelor vizuale reale în fluxuri AI, cum ar fi detecția obiectelor sau înțelegerea scenelor.
  • Gestionarea conexiunilor cu webcam-ul
    Oferă unelte pentru deschiderea, gestionarea și închiderea conexiunilor cu camera programatic, sprijinind utilizarea dinamică în sisteme de automatizare mai complexe.

Cum se configurează

Windsurf

Nu sunt furnizate instrucțiuni de configurare pentru Windsurf.

Claude

macOS/Linux

  1. Asigură-te că ai instalat: Python 3.10+, OpenCV (opencv-python), MCP Python SDK, UV (opțional).
  2. Clonează depozitul și instalează:
    git clone https://github.com/13rac1/videocapture-mcp.git
    cd videocapture-mcp
    pip install -e .
    
  3. Editează fișierul de configurare Claude Desktop:
    • Mac: nano ~/Library/Application\ Support/Claude/claude_desktop_config.json
    • Linux: nano ~/.config/Claude/claude_desktop_config.json
  4. Adaugă configurația serverului MCP:
    {
      "mcpServers": {
        "VideoCapture": {
          "command": "uv",
          "args": [
            "run",
            "--with",
            "mcp[cli]",
            "--with",
            "numpy",
            "--with",
            "opencv-python",
            "mcp",
            "run",
            "/ABSOLUTE_PATH/videocapture_mcp.py"
          ]
        }
      }
    }
    
  5. Înlocuiește /ABSOLUTE_PATH/videocapture-mcp cu calea absolută către proiect.
  6. Repornește Claude Desktop și verifică accesibilitatea serverului MCP.

Windows

  1. Asigură-te că ai instalat toate cerințele.
  2. Editează configurația:
    nano $env:AppData\Claude\claude_desktop_config.json
    
  3. Adaugă configurația:
    {
      "mcpServers": {
        "VideoCapture": {
          "command": "uv",
          "args": [
            "run",
            "--with",
            "mcp[cli]",
            "--with",
            "numpy",
            "--with",
            "opencv-python",
            "mcp",
            "run",
            "C:\\ABSOLUTE_PATH\\videocapture-mcp\\videocapture_mcp.py"
          ]
        }
      }
    }
    
  4. Înlocuiește C:\ABSOLUTE_PATH\videocapture-mcp corespunzător.
  5. Repornește Claude Desktop și verifică.

Comandă alternativă de instalare

  • Rulează:
    mcp install videocapture_mcp.py
    
    Aceasta va configura automat Claude Desktop pentru a folosi Video Still Capture MCP.

Cursor

Nu sunt furnizate instrucțiuni de configurare pentru Cursor.

Cline

Nu sunt furnizate instrucțiuni de configurare pentru Cline.

Securizarea cheilor API

Nu există informații despre securizarea cheilor API sau a variabilelor de mediu în documentație.

Cum folosești acest MCP în fluxuri

Utilizarea MCP în FlowHunt

Pentru a integra servere MCP în fluxul tău FlowHunt, începe prin a adăuga componenta MCP în flux și conecteaz-o la agentul tău AI:

Flux MCP FlowHunt

Fă clic pe componenta MCP pentru a deschide panoul de configurare. În secțiunea de configurare a sistemului MCP, introdu detaliile serverului tău MCP folosind acest format JSON:

{
  "VideoCapture": {
    "transport": "streamable_http",
    "url": "https://yourmcpserver.example/pathtothemcp/url"
  }
}

După configurare, agentul AI va putea folosi acest MCP ca unealtă, având acces la toate funcțiile și capabilitățile sale. Nu uita să schimbi “VideoCapture” cu numele real al serverului tău MCP și să înlocuiești URL-ul cu adresa serverului tău MCP.


Prezentare generală

SecțiuneDisponibilitateDetalii/Note
Prezentare generalăPrezentare în README
Listă de prompt-uriNu sunt menționate șabloane de prompt
Listă de resurseNu sunt documentate resurse MCP explicite
Listă de uneltequick_capture documentat în README
Securizarea cheilor APINu există detalii despre securizarea cheilor sau variabile
Suport pentru sampling (mai puțin relevant)Nu este menționat

Opinia noastră

Video Still Capture MCP este un server MCP concentrat și bine definit pentru captură de imagini de la webcam, cu documentație clară pentru integrarea cu Claude și o interfață de unealtă directă. Totuși, în prezent lipsesc șabloanele de prompt, primitivele de resurse și documentația pentru configurare multiplatformă sau securitate. Abordarea cu o singură unealtă este eficientă pentru scopul său, dar limitează extensibilitatea.

Scor MCP

Are LICENSE⛔ (Nu a fost găsit fișier LICENSE)
Are cel puțin o unealtă
Număr de Fork-uri1
Număr de Stele10

Rating: 4/10
Serverul își face treaba foarte bine pentru captură de imagini, însă este limitat ca scop, lipsindu-i funcționalități MCP avansate, documentație pentru resurse și ghiduri de configurare multiplatformă.

Întrebări frecvente

Ce este Serverul Video Still Capture MCP?

Este un server Model Context Protocol bazat pe Python care permite asistenților AI să captureze imagini de la webcam-uri, să ajusteze setările camerei și să efectueze procesare de bază a imaginilor prin interfețe standardizate folosind OpenCV.

Ce unelte oferă acest server MCP?

Instrumentul documentat este 'quick_capture', care permite agenților AI sau dezvoltatorilor să captureze o singură imagine statică de la o cameră compatibilă OpenCV fără a gestiona conexiuni persistente.

Care sunt cazurile de utilizare comune?

Scenariile includ captură de imagini în timp real pentru analiză, ajustarea setărilor camerei, preprocesare simplă a imaginilor (cum ar fi oglindirea orizontală) și integrarea datelor vizuale în fluxuri AI sau sisteme de automatizare.

Cum configurez serverul pentru Claude Desktop?

Instalează Python 3.10+, OpenCV și MCP SDK, clonează depozitul, adaugă configurația în fișierul de configurare Claude conform documentației, apoi repornește Claude Desktop pentru a activa serverul MCP.

Serverul suportă mai multe platforme?

Instrucțiunile de configurare sunt oferite în principal pentru Claude Desktop pe macOS, Linux și Windows. Documentația pentru Windsurf, Cursor și Cline nu este furnizată.

Există documentație pentru prompt sau resurse?

Nu există șabloane explicite de prompt sau primitive de resurse documentate pentru acest server MCP.

Care este statutul licențierii?

Nu a fost găsit niciun fișier LICENSE în depozit la ultima verificare.

Integrează Video Still Capture MCP cu FlowHunt

Oferă superputere fluxurilor tale AI prin captură în timp real de imagini de la webcam și gestionare a camerelor cu Video Still Capture MCP. Încearcă-l acum în FlowHunt pentru o integrare perfectă a datelor vizuale.

Află mai multe

Serverul OpenCV MCP
Serverul OpenCV MCP

Serverul OpenCV MCP

Serverul OpenCV MCP face legătura între instrumentele puternice de procesare a imaginilor și videoclipurilor oferite de OpenCV și asistenții AI sau platformele ...

4 min citire
OpenCV MCP Server +4
Integrarea serverului VMS MCP
Integrarea serverului VMS MCP

Integrarea serverului VMS MCP

Serverul VMS MCP face legătura între asistenții AI ai FlowHunt și sistemele reale de supraveghere video, permițând controlul programatic al CCTV și software-ulu...

4 min citire
AI Security +5
ScreenshotOne MCP Server
ScreenshotOne MCP Server

ScreenshotOne MCP Server

ScreenshotOne MCP Server conectează asistenții AI cu API-ul ScreenshotOne, permițând capturarea automată a capturilor de ecran ale site-urilor web pentru dezvol...

4 min citire
AI MCP Server +6